Parking must be per City Zoning Code and City Design and <br /> Construction Standards and Specifications. For the 63,400 <br /> square feet of clinic space proposed, a minimum of 317 parking <br /> stalls is required. <br /> Note: The Applicant has requested reducing the amount of <br /> parking provided by lo$ of the Zoning Code requirement. As a <br /> result, the proposal would provide a total of 285 parking <br /> , stalls, rather than the 317 required by code. In order for the <br /> requested parking reduction to be approved, the Planning <br /> Director must find that the proposal meets the criteria set <br /> forth in Subsection 34.070 of the Zoning Code. A decision on <br /> this request will be issued concurrently with the final MDNS. <br /> 13. Landscaping must be provided per Sections 25 and 35 of the <br /> Zoning Code. At a minimum this must include the following: <br /> a. a landscape strip a minimum of l0 feet wide must be provided <br /> in the front yard setback area along the Maple Street <br /> frontage, except for the driveway and pedestrian entrance. <br /> This area shall be planted with Type III landscaping. <br /> b. Landscaping must be provided along the side and rear <br /> property lines, unless the buildinq is constructed to the � <br /> lot line, in which case no landscapinq is required in these <br /> areas. Any landscaping provided in these areas must be to <br /> Type III standard. <br /> c. Prior to issuance of any permits, landscapinq plans must be <br /> reviewed and approved by the Planning Department per Section <br /> 35.100 of the 2oning Code. The landscaping plan must show <br /> location of required grassy swales, rockeries and retaining <br /> walls, and grading at 5 foot intervals. Irrigation systems <br /> must be provided in all landscaped areas per Section 35.130 <br /> of the Zoning Code. A 2 year maintenance assurance device <br /> must be provided for the landscaping per Section 35.130 B of <br /> the 2oning Code. <br /> 5 <br />
